Output 3525079c01e41665ed346f3f76525127f625444b37191d0a932fc1f67c95bd89:0

value
264629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c102e5eeb3916c633a5ceb7fd9f138660361649c OP_EQUAL
address
3KHZowDnmhZdubcik29VkoxghcyZiTdtby
transaction
3525079c01e41665ed346f3f76525127f625444b37191d0a932fc1f67c95bd89
spent
true